If you add up the number of Lugers included in the Bannerman purchase you will come up with 772 (not 770 as it appears in most literature). The range 6361-7108 includes both the beginning serial number and the ending serial number so it accounts for 749 weapons (and not 748 which is the difference between the two numbers). The same applies for 6176-6196 which is 21 weapons. Adding in the two single examples, 6282 and 7147, you get 772. I think that faiure to take this into account resulted in the 770 figure.
At any rate, 1000 minus 770 is 230, the number of "missing" pieces (actually should be 228).
